Our ground-breaking dementia care home which opened in 2016 is based on the 'Butterfly Household Model of Care' where the environment is designed with small household living which is as homely as possible.

Two cockapoos helped light up the faces of our Gosforth residents this week!
Lisa, who works in the kitchen at our Gosforth care home, brought in her pair of pooches to meet everyone, much to the delight of staff and residents alike.
Research shows that as well as being generally lovely to be around, pets can help increase activity levels, combat loneliness and reduce stress and depression (https://continuing-healthcare.co.uk/continuing-healthcare-guidance/a-look-at-pet-therapy-in-care-homes/).
We try to have furry visitors as often as possible in our care homes – it is always such a joy to see the happiness they bring to everyone at Eothen.
